WebOcean waters range from 0.0153 to 0.0156 mole % deuterium, whereas fresh waters of the United States range from 0.0133 to 0.0154 mole % deuterium. WebFor instance 16 O (the most common isotope of oxygen with eight protons and eight neutrons) is roughly 2632 times more prevalent in sea water than is 17 O (with an additional neutron). The isotopic ratios of VSMOW water are defined as follows: 2 H / 1 H = 155.76 ± 0.1 ppm (a ratio of 1 part per approximately 6420 parts) [2] WebFortunately, deuterium is common.
